When pride comes, then comes shame; But with the humble [is] wisdom. Proverbs 11:2 NKJV
When we think of the word sin, our minds usually move to the “biggies”: murder, sexual immorality, theft, blasphemy, and others. But when you look at the message of the bible as a whole, you’ll see that at the heart of any sin we can commit is this five-letter word for something God really hates: pride.
Pride can be defined as believing you can handle your life better than God can. And while it’s easy to say you trust God, it’s even easier to have an attitude of pride, and attitude that says to God, “It’s okay…I’ve got this.”
That kind of thinking can lead you to all kinds of places in life, and none of them good
Even a little bit of pride can lead a man into disastrous decisions—in his walk with God, in his marriage, in his relationship with his children, in his ministry…the list is long and distinguished. But humility before God and others leads to good decisions and to the very best God has for you.
Prayer: Lord, Your Word repeatedly warns me against the sin of pride, which is me trusting in and depending on myself instead of You. Lord, keep me from making a mess of my life through human pride. Instead, help me to glorify You as I humbly seek You each day.
